Steve's 
Library Staff Pick:
Dead Wake:
The Last Crossing Of The Lusitania
Dead Wake is author Erik Larson's narrative of the people, events, and political machinations that culminated in one of the most tragic maritime tragedies in history - the sinking of the Lusitania. Larson interweaves portraits of passengers, crew members, and the Lusitania itself with those of the U-boat captain and crew, along with both the German and British politicians and military leaders to create an engrossing story. The author has created a must-read account of how the United States was finally dragged into World War I. This book transcends dry history, bringing it to life.

Insider Tip . . . from Terry:  helpful tips Terry Zignego
Want to avoid late fines while taking library items on vacation? No problem at the Delafield Public Library! Just ask for an extended check out period and we are happy to oblige.
